Transaction 50dba4110b64989cff2b69d7f4daeb60261f34677c6062a01beea355e428176e

1 Input
2 Outputs
  • 50dba4110b64989cff2b69d7f4daeb60261f34677c6062a01beea355e428176e:0
  • value  1342656
    address  14tvCFBHKpdJ5rft6KYmSwFC9ouu2McvcR
  • 50dba4110b64989cff2b69d7f4daeb60261f34677c6062a01beea355e428176e:1
  • value  5725481
    address  bc1q2p7c65ufukpxda77uysvpded03vx87ckjm50mp